What is the housing situation like in Brazil's riverside communities?

Riverside communities in Brazil often face challenges in terms of access to adequate housing due to location in flood-prone areas and lack of basic infrastructure. Housing programs have been implemented to improve living conditions in these communities, but there are still unmet needs in terms of decent and safe housing.

What is the process for the conditional release of inmates in Panama?

The conditional release of prisoners in Panama involves a legal process that allows certain prisoners to serve the remainder of their sentences outside of prison, subject to compliance with specific conditions. This is done to encourage rehabilitation and social reintegration.

How is the participation of minors in decisions about their adoption in Guatemala legally regulated?

The participation of minors in decisions about their adoption is legally regulated in Guatemala. Depending on the age and capacity of the child, mechanisms can be implemented to listen to their opinion and take it into account in the adoption process, always prioritizing their well-being.

What is the Non-Resident Income Tax in the Dominican Republic?

The Non-Resident Income Tax in the Dominican Republic applies to individuals and legal entities that do not have tax residence in the country but obtain income from sources within the Dominican Republic. This income can include property rentals, dividends, interest, among others. The tax is calculated by applying a fixed or progressive rate depending on the type of income and is presented in annual tax returns. Non-residents must comply with tax regulations to declare and pay this tax if applicable
